WebFeb 22, 2024 · There is liturgical significance in the use of the palms from Palm Sunday, as opposed to other materials, to make the ashes for Ash Wednesday. Father Randy Stice, associate director for the Secretariat of Divine Worship for the U.S. Bishops' Conference, told CNA that the ashes made from palms remind us of what Lent is all about. WebJan 9, 2024 · Palm Branches on Palm Sunday In the Bible, Jesus ' Triumphal Entry into Jerusalem with the waving of palm branches is found in John 12: 12-15; Matthew 21:1-11; Mark 11:1-11; and Luke 19:28-44. Today Palm Sunday is celebrated one week before Easter, on the first day of Holy Week.

WebMar 6, 2024 · There are six Sundays in Lent, including Passion Sunday. The ashes used for Ash Wednesday are made from the burned and blessed palms of the previous year’s Palm Sunday. “The palms are burned ...
